Find out more at www.pwc.com. **Role Overview** * We are seeking an experienced Application Maintenance Engineer to support the System for a long-term application maintenance and support engagement. The candidate will provide Level 2 and Level 3 support, ensuring the availability, stability, performance, and integrity of critical production and non-production environments. * This role requires strong hands-on experience in the Microsoft technology stack, system integration, database support, incident/problem management, and production support operations. The candidate must be able to work onsite at the client’s office (9am-6pm) and provide onsite support during major events as required. * In addition, the role is expected to provide end-to-end application maintenance services, including incident investigation, resolution management, and bug fixes. How to Apply on Workday
- Workday has a multi-step form — save your progress after every section.
- "Apply With LinkedIn" can fail or lose data; manual entry is more reliable.
- Watch for the "Submit for Review" final step — hitting "Save" alone does not submit.
- Job requisition numbers are useful when following up with HR by email.
